Overview

The Moondrop Space Travel 2 Ultra represents a significant technological achievement in the TWS earbuds market, incorporating the company’s patented 13mm single-magnetic annular planar driver technology at an accessible price point [1]. Founded in 2015 and based in Chengdu, China, Moondrop has established itself as a leading Chi-Fi manufacturer known for scientifically-based approaches and exceptional cost-performance ratios. The Space Travel 2 Ultra builds upon this legacy by bringing flagship planar magnetic technology to the wireless earbuds segment, featuring noise cancellation, Bluetooth 6.0 connectivity, and LDAC high-resolution audio support [1]. The product demonstrates Moondrop’s commitment to measurement-driven development philosophy [4], positioning it as an innovative entry in the competitive TWS market.

Technology Level

\[\Large \text{0.8}\]

The Space Travel 2 Ultra demonstrates advanced technological sophistication through multiple notable implementations. The patented 13mm single-magnetic annular planar driver represents a significant engineering achievement in a proprietary planar magnetic circuit design [1][3]. Advanced wireless technology integration includes claimed Bluetooth 6.0 adoption (verification required for this cutting-edge specification in consumer TWS earbuds), combined with LDAC codec support enabling high-resolution audio streaming up to 24-bit/96kHz [1]. The integration of sophisticated digital signal processing, patent-protected driver technology, and advanced wireless processing capabilities creates meaningful competitive advantages, positioning this product among the technologically advanced TWS products while not yet representing world-leading innovation across all technical aspects.

Cost-Performance

\[\Large \text{1.0}\]

This site evaluates based solely on functionality and measured performance values, without considering driver types or configurations. The Space Travel 2 Ultra is priced at 39.99 USD in the current market [1]. Comprehensive functional analysis identifies the QCY MeloBuds Pro as the primary comparison target, equipped with equivalent user-facing functions including LDAC codec support and ANC capability with quantified 46dB ANC performance [2]. Current market research indicates QCY MeloBuds Pro pricing around 45 USD, making it more expensive than the review target. While some retail channels may offer lower pricing (potentially 30-35 USD), verified current market prices position the Space Travel 2 Ultra as competitively priced among LDAC-enabled ANC TWS earbuds. No equivalent alternatives with LDAC support and ANC functionality are available at verified lower pricing in the current market. The Space Travel 2 Ultra represents strong cost-performance as an affordable entry point for LDAC streaming and noise cancellation technology.

Reliability & Support

\[\Large \text{0.6}\]

The Space Travel 2 Ultra receives standard 1-year warranty coverage against manufacturing defects, which falls below the industry average 2-year benchmark. Construction advantages include solid-state design with no mechanical moving parts, providing inherent resistance to typical failure modes associated with TWS earbuds. Moondrop maintains an established reliability track record with previous products and provides global distribution through multiple authorized dealers including HiFiGO, Linsoul Audio, and ShenzhenaAudio. The company provides standard manufacturer support channels with typical 1-5 year support windows expected, though specific long-term parts availability remains unclear for this newer product. The combination of robust construction design and established manufacturer reputation balances against the shorter standard warranty period, resulting in average reliability and support expectations for the product category.
